About A. Schroth
A. Schroth is a scholar working on Aerospace Engineering, Atmospheric Science, Environmental Engineering, Global and Planetary Change and Oceanography, having authored 47 papers that have together received 342 indexed citations. Recurring topics across this work include Precipitation Measurement and Analysis (23 papers), Soil Moisture and Remote Sensing (15 papers), Radio Wave Propagation Studies (8 papers), Radar Systems and Signal Processing (7 papers), Atmospheric aerosols and clouds (7 papers), Synthetic Aperture Radar (SAR) Applications and Techniques (6 papers), Antenna Design and Optimization (5 papers) and Advanced SAR Imaging Techniques (5 papers). The work is most often cited by research in Aerospace Engineering (198 citations), Atmospheric Science (126 citations), Environmental Engineering (82 citations), Oceanography (41 citations) and Global and Planetary Change (69 citations). A. Schroth has collaborated with scholars based in Germany, Russia and United States. Frequent co-authors include Thomas Sauer, A. Hornbostel, Achim Dreher, Frank Klefenz, Volker Ziegler, B. G. Kutuza, Bernd M. Rode, Clemens Simmer, Mathias Schneider and Susanne Crewell. Their work appears in journals such as Journal of Electromagnetic Waves and Applications, Organic Letters, IEEE Transactions on Control Systems Technology, IEEE Transactions on Microwave Theory and Techniques and Journal of Atmospheric and Oceanic Technology.
